Japanese Tenugui Crane & Fuji cadeau Handcrafted in Gunma prefectureJapanese cotton tenugui with crane and Mount Fuji print Used in Japan for centuries, tenugui is a piece of cotton fabric that can be used as a towel, fashion accessory, for wrapping or as a wall decoration. This model, with its magnificent print depicting two Japanese cranes in front of Mount Fuji, will look great against a wall. You can frame it or hang it on a wooden support.
